OverviewThis text focuses on the latest discoveries on calreticulin, calnexin and other endoplasmic reticulum proteins. Calreticulin has been implicated to affect diverse cellular function and play a role in many pathologies including protein folding disorders, cardiac pathologies, cancer and autoimmunity. The book contains contribution form the world leaders in the area of endoplasmic reticulum function, protein folding, calcium homeostasis and autoimmunity. It raises many questions about calreticulin, calnexin and the endoplasmic reticulum and gives an opportunity to realize the significance of these calcium-binding chaperones.
